Output 53afbb6b33f454267730ec1e2fa22031ceb2d9c17c3f1aa57af486e65e30a4b8:7

value
479181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74acb789a2a006dabc3e7a1cd553bd2f6ed55fcf OP_EQUAL
address
3CKwDNyfJwycjvRLxqyRSfGKWoB17XgqfL
transaction
53afbb6b33f454267730ec1e2fa22031ceb2d9c17c3f1aa57af486e65e30a4b8
spent
true